A circular walk is 1.5 meters wide, if the outer circumference is 72 meters, what is the inside diameter of the walk?​

Answers

9514 1404 393

Answer:

  about 19.92 meters

Step-by-step explanation:

The circumference is ...

  C = πd

  72 m = πd . . . . . for outer diameter d

  d = (72 m)/π

The inner diameter is 3 meters shorter, so is ...

  inner diameter = (72/π) m - 3 m ≈ 19.92 m

Express q/4p−q/p as a single fraction

Answers

Answer: -3q/4p

I hope this helps

The fraction q/4p−q/p as a single fraction is −3q/4p.

We are given that;

The fraction= q/4p−q/p

Now,

A fraction represents a part of a number or any number of equal parts.

To express q/4p−q/p as a single fraction, we need to find a common denominator for the two fractions and subtract them. The least common multiple of 4p and p is 4p, so we can multiply the second fraction by 4/4 to get an equivalent fraction with the same denominator:

q/4p−q/p = q/4p−(q/p)(4/4) = q/4p−4q/4p

Now we can subtract the fractions by subtracting the numerators and keeping the denominator:

q/4p−4q/4p = (q−4q)/4p = −3q/4p

Therefore, by the fraction answer will be −3q/4p.

A health fitness research group wishes to estimate the mean amount of time (in hours) that members of a fitness center spend each week exercising at the center. They want to estimate the mean within a margin of error of 0.4 hours with a 95% level of confidence. Previous data suggest that the population standard deviation (sigma) is 2.6 hours. What is the smallest sample size that meets these criteria

Answers

Answer:

the smallest sample size is 163

Step-by-step explanation:

The computation of the smallest sample size that meets these criteria is shown below:

n = (Z a/2 ×  Standard deviation  ÷ Margin of error ) ^2

Zα/2 at 0.05% LOS is = 1.96 ( From Standard Normal Table )

Standard Deviation ( S.D) = 2.6

Margin of error i.e. ME =0.4

n = ( 1.96 × 2.6 ÷ 0.4) ^2

= 163

Hence, the smallest sample size is 163

Factor Completely:

16x8−81y8

Answers

Answer:

Step-by-step explanation:

16x⁸ - 81y⁸ is the difference of squares.

16x⁸ - 81y⁸ = (4x⁴)² - (9y⁴)² = (4x⁴ + 9y⁴)(4x⁴ - 9y⁴)

Note that 4x⁴ - 9y⁴ is also the difference of squares.

4x⁴ - 9y⁴ = (2x²) - (3y²)² = (2x² + 3y²)(2x² - 3y²)

16x⁸ - 81y⁸ = (4x⁴ + 9y⁴)(2x² + 3y²)(2x² - 3y²)
